  • The race for 6th-generation fighter dominance goes beyond technological advancements. With AI-powered weaponry, unmatched data processing capabilities, and the strategic integration of drone companions, this battle is redefining aerial supremacy. Combat strategies are evolving rapidly, and we're about to uncover every detail in this video.
    A standout feature of our exploration is the "Next Generation Air Dominance Fighter (NGAD)" program by the United States Air Force. This ambitious endeavor aims not just to replace the F-22 Raptor, but to establish an entity that truly rules the skies. Prepare to be amazed by innovative technologies such as advanced combined-cycle afterburning turbofan engines and AI-controlled drones that are shaping the next era of aerial warfare.
    But the competition isn't limited to the United States and its rivals. China is making its own entries, such as the J-20 Mighty Dragon and the Shenyang FC-31 Gyrfalcon, both equipped with cutting-edge stealth capabilities and technology. Additionally, Russia is in the running with the Sukhoi Su-57 Felon, a fighter promising unmatched maneuverability and firepower.

      ACTUALLY…(yep. I’m that guy), the United States designed, developed, and fielded a hypersonic anti-ballistic missile system over 55 years ago. “Nike Sprint”.
      From ignition it took the Sprint a whole FIVE SECONDS to reach Mach 10. That is not a typo.
      The United States nailed hypersonics to the wall over half a century ago. The real difficulty is managing heat and being able to properly guide anything moving that fast - It becomes enveloped in a cloud of plasma that impedes radio communication and guidance. The leaps in materials and guidance in the last 50 years has made the capability far more likely to actually be utilized.
      Speed? Been there, done that, walked away because the real sorcery is seen in the degree of precision the US is capable of now. Almost all of the benefits of that much speed can be (and has been) super ceded with RIDICULOUSLY precise conventional weapons.
